  • Patent number: 10384883
    Abstract: Systems and methods that utilize a card reorienting mechanism are described. Generally, the card reorienting mechanism can transport and rotate a card without substantially contacting one of the principal surfaces of the card. The use of the card reorienting mechanism permits reorienting of the card without substantially contacting the principal surface of the card after the operation has been performed on the principal surface of the card. The card reorienting mechanism of the present disclosure can be useful where rotation of the card without contacting the principal surfaces of the card is desired moments after ink is applied to one of the principal surfaces of the card. In addition, substantially the entire principle surface is accessible for processing operations while the card is on the reorienting mechanism, such as for laser personalization or for image capture.

  • Patent number: 9751253
    Abstract: A substrate de-bowing mechanism, system and method are described. The mechanism can include a substrate support, one or more stationary contact members, and one or more dynamic or movable contact members that are adapted to contact the substrate and bend the substrate in a desired direction to reduce or eliminate bowing of the substrate. The mechanism is controlled by a CPU or other controller that can adjust the de-bow parameters of the de-bowing mechanism based on input settings that can be dynamic and/or static settings. The mechanism can be used to de-bow a variety of substrates including plastic cards, passports, and passport pages.
